COM. v. CARRIER


494 Pa. 305 (1981)

431 A.2d 271

COMMONWEALTH of Pennsylvania v. Stanley G. CARRIER, Jr., Appellant.

Supreme Court of Pennsylvania.

Decided July 2, 1981.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Michael M. Mamula, Richard E. Goldinger, Nancy T. Blewett, Butler, for appellant.

Robert J. Felton, Asst. Dist. Atty., Meadville, for appellee.

Before O'BRIEN, C.J., and ROBERTS, NIX, LARSEN, FLAHERTY, KAUFFMAN and WILKINSON, JJ.


OPINION OF THE COURT

WILKINSON, Justice.

This is an appeal from a dismissal without a hearing of appellant's pro se petition filed under the Post Conviction Hearing Act (PCHA)1 by the Court of Common Pleas of Crawford County. For the reasons stated hereinafter, we remand this case for proceedings consistent with this opinion.
